Output 04d86698530bd88d76667b7930d362fff84565d27d46ad33ba876ed51f61ad06:0

value
29956176
script pubkey
OP_0 OP_PUSHBYTES_20 7600d5f77cdefc4aa6010a262a5589e6283841c3
address
bc1qwcqdtamumm7y4fsppgnz54vfuc5rsswr33ued9
transaction
04d86698530bd88d76667b7930d362fff84565d27d46ad33ba876ed51f61ad06
confirmations
39754
spent
true